    I assume the majority of the 'myth-making' takes place on internet shaving chat forums where an opinion is given, read and dispersed forthwith in repeated postings as "fact."
    Part of this lie/myth/fabrication may also stem from the more aggressive 'toothy' appearance of the OC razors, which lack the 'safety bar.':eek:
    By design, more blade is exposed, hence the idea that the OCRs must be inherently more aggressive.
    Personally, I have found that all my Gillettes, OC or not, tended to be mild shavers.
    Now the slant bars—THEY tend to be more aggressive.....;)

    Agree with all but maybe one point - more blade being exposed. Is it really? (honestly asking) If the blade was actually resting on the teeth I might agree, but all razors have a blade gap, and we know that those with a larger blade gap are the ones that are more aggressive. I would argue that the entire length of the edge of the blade contacts the skin, regardless of being an open comb or straight bar razor. Again, it is the gap that determines the amount of aggression.
